It was only a few hours ago when we discussed how the next-generation Volvo XC90 could be called Embla and now its mechanically related Polestar model is being teased. It’s not the first preview of the electric SUV, but it’s by far the most revealing so far since it shows a production-ready prototype featuring a thin body wrap leaving little to the imagination.

While parent company Volvo will sell the midsize zero-emissions SUV with three-row seating, Polestar won’t be doing the same since its own version will be sportier and likely a tad lighter by coming only with two rows. Even if it’s fully disguised, the vehicle shows a swoopy shape whereas the equivalent XC90 / Embla will be boxier and therefore roomier on the inside.

Both of them will share the assembly line at the factory located in Charleston, South Carolina where the electric SUVs are scheduled to enter production in 2022. The first Polestar to be built in North America is going to feature a LIDAR sensor and NVIDIA computing power to give the vehicle a highly advanced autonomous driving system on the highway.

The Polestar 3 has been previously confirmed to feature a more powerful dual-motor setup than its Volvo counterpart and will come with all-wheel drive. Eschewing the third row will free up more legroom for passengers sitting in the back, but the more sloped roofline will result in less headroom compared to the Embla.

It’s going to be approximately the same size as the XC90 replacement and both will ride on the dedicated electric SPA2 architecture enabling a completely flat floor design and short overhangs. The shape has “nothing to do” with the Volvo, according to Polestar boss Thomas Ingenlath. That’s because the Polestar 3 – which will carry a starting price of around €75,000 in Europe – will be more aerodynamic and aggressive while the Embla will play it safe in terms of design.

It will be followed in 2023 by the Polestar 4 as a more affordable SUV serving as a coupe-styled alternative to the existing Polestar 2. As for the Polestar 5, the grand tourer is set for a 2024 launch as a production version of the stunning Percept concept. Meanwhile, the Polestar 1 plug-in hybrid sports coupe will be retired by the end of this year.

The Polestar 3 was originally teased back in mid-June, but there hasn’t been any news about the electric SUV since then. Thankfully, Car and Driver was able to obtain some preliminary technical specifications after having a chat with Polestar CEO Thomas Ingenlath. While the next-generation Volvo XC90 will offer an EV option likely combined with three rows, the Polestar 3 will be available strictly with two rows of seats.

Granted, that’s not all too surprising seeing as how the vehicle hiding under the cover has a sloping roofline that would make it quite difficult to cram in more than four/five seats in the cabin. Ingenlath explained he has nothing against three-row vehicles, but argues offering a seven-seat option would have made some people wonder how the Polestar 3 differs from the mechanically related XC90.

He went on to mention sticking to two rows allows Polestar to offer more room between the front and rear seats to enable a “luxurious feeling” while improving aerodynamics thanks to the swoopy roofline. Consequently, expect copious amounts of rear legroom and a low drag coefficient for an SUV.

While the Polestar 3 and next-gen Volvo XC90 EV will share most of the bits and pieces, aside from being built at the same South Carolina plant in the US, there will be one key difference between the two. Ingenlath told C&D the Polestar 3 will be fitted with a powertrain that will give it “a top power position that is unique to Polestar.”

Much like the zero-emissions XC90, the new Polestar 3 will come with a choice of single- and dual-motor versions, with the latter offering all-wheel drive. Ingenlath argues variety is the spice of life as offering multiple powertrain options will cater to various customer demands all over the world, with some regions preferring AWD while others will go for the single-motor setup.

The official reveal is expected to take place in the coming months, but the Polestar 3 won’t arrive in the United States until at some point next year when it will be advertised as a 2023MY product.

After a high-performance coupe equipped with a plug-in hybrid signaling Polestar’s transformation into a standalone brand, the Volvo-owned company then came out with the Polestar 2 hatchback to rival the Tesla Model 3. It’s now getting ready to come after the Model X by unveiling a fully electric SUV developed from day one on an EV-exclusive architecture.

Teased under a car cover, the Polestar 3 will have an exterior appearance previewed last year by the Precept concept. The firm’s design boss previously said the concept’s styling will inspire the SUV by adopting a similar minimalist approach, including for the cabin where a large touchscreen will replace most conventional buttons.

One major difference between the Polestar 3 and the two preceding models will be the production location as the electric SUV will be built in the United States. Specifically, it’s going to be put together in South Carolina at the factory in Ridgeville where the Volvo S60 is currently made. At the very same plant, the all-new XC90 coming in 2022 will hit the assembly line, likely with an EV option.

North American customers will be glad to hear they won’t have to wait a long time to get behind the wheel of the Polestar 3 after placing an order. That obviously has to do with the fact it will be built in SC, thus significantly reducing the waiting times. The electric SUV will also come at a lower starting price compared to an imported car from China as it’s the case with the Polestar 1 coupe and Polestar 2.

Polestar promises a highly advanced autonomous driving system for its first SUV, along with state-of-the-art infotainment running on Android Automotive OS. The company remains tight-lipped about the technical specifications but promises it will have fully-fledged performance car capabilities and a highly aerodynamic body.

A full reveal is expected to take place in the coming months, ahead of 2022 when production is programmed to start.
